Transaction 94889baed68b6f854201791eafcfdb2dc6c26d1be6b6aa116f58450660e9bf94
1 Input
1 Output
-
94889baed68b6f854201791eafcfdb2dc6c26d1be6b6aa116f58450660e9bf94:0
- value
- 2843136
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 64e1a8f31f04a9a71b224bd3af8ae8a316919019 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ACQuK6Hvqf8jQBSfsBRWURmLs9K9S3nrL